  7. I like reading literature because I think it’s interesting and educational to read about other perspectives on the human experience. If you just read non fiction you lose a lot of the humanity of things imo. For example if you read war and peace you will gain a lot that simply reading a history book about the Napoleónic wars won’t touch on imo

  12. Well concentration meditation aka watching breath isn’t designed to bring spiritual insight. It’s designed to tranquilize and regulate your nervous system. It is insight/ vipassana style practices which are designed to bring you spiritual insights. These are things like Mahasi method and noting.
